## Transcript

I'm a sucker for badges and achievements. Now that the Steam Deck has come out, I've literally bought games that I already own on my Nintendo Switch just to get the Steam Achievements. I don't know what it is, but even though rationally I know that they're worthless, I feel like I'm accomplishing something by getting achievements.

That's one of the reasons that I go achievement hunting on Insider Connected for Stern pinball machines. I find it to be addictive. This morning Stern pinball launched a whole slew of new Insider Connected badges for its new Foo Fighters pinball machine. Registered Insider Connected players who play a Foo Fighters pin on the day of one of the bands tour stops receive a special badge for their account. Each badge has neat custom art. I'll tell you right now that if I owned a Foo Fighters machine, you can bet that I'd make sure that I get every single one of these. Players who get them all receive a special "Tour Saved" achievement badge. Cool idea.
